DAPK3 — EPHB2

Text-mined interactions from Literome

Chen et al., EMBO J 2005 : Phosphorylation of DAPK at Ser 735 by ERK increases the catalytic activity of DAPK both in vitro and in vivo ... Conversely, DAPK promotes the cytoplasmic retention of ERK , thereby inhibiting ERK signaling in the nucleus
